Learn about car insurance for teenagers, tips to help them drive safely, teen driving laws and more. dancing moose farmsWebQ: When can I add dependents to my health plan? A: You can add new family members to your plan in special cases: Newborn baby: Add within 60 days of birth. Adopted child: Add within 60 days of placement. New spouse: Add within 60 days of marriage.
